Job Overview:
A prestigious law firm is seeking an experienced Infrastructure Associate to join its esteemed practice group. The role offers an opportunity to work on high-profile public civil works projects, with a focus on innovative delivery of large infrastructure projects. The firm seeks a candidate with expertise in construction law, real estate law, public contract law, and/or transportation regulatory law. The position is available in multiple office locations and offers substantial responsibility, a hybrid work environment, and excellent opportunities for career growth.
